Handover: Thumbwright queue

Welcome to the media team. The Thumbwright thumbnail generation queue consumes upload events from the Gravelholt bus and writes renditions to cold storage within roughly thirty seconds. Known quirks: GIFs over 50 MB are silently skipped, and the retry worker must be restarted after any broker failover. Dashboards live in the ops folder; alerts page the media rotation. When setting up a local worker, start it with the configuration values below.

deployment values, tafog-fajef:
[jorox]
team = norael
access_code = ac_b6e7bf
owner = oliael.silwyn
host = jorox.qorveltech.internal
port = 8443
peer = oliius.paliqlabs.local
salt = 0b6288ee
pin = 8391

CI note — FormulaVault sandbox failures. User-supplied formulas in the Calcwright pipeline are escaping the eval sandbox when nested IMPORT() calls exceed depth 3. The sandbox runner kills the job but CI marks it flaky instead of failed, so retries pile up. Workaround: set SANDBOX_DEPTH_CAP=2 in the job env until the parser patch lands. Do not whitelist customer formulas manually. If a support case references this, capture the failing run and quote the trace token below.

trace token, fafog-kageg: htk4_98e6

Facilities Ticket — Mail Room Relocation (Harwick House, Level 2)

The mail room is moving from Level 2 to the ground floor beside the loading bay, effective Monday. All outgoing parcels should be dropped at the new counter from that date; the old room will be locked for refurbishment. Assistants collecting department post will need to pass through the service corridor, which is badge-controlled. Until permanent badges are reprogrammed, please use the temporary code below.

badge for kadug-tafof: bdg-SV-6